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27280035 8036 6039727252 740 641227506
1590249 72 3405
1590249 72 3405
33022211366 3003 0613952916 1842
All about undefined
Interested in learning more?
1590249 72 3405
33022211366 3003 0613952916 1842
See more
6593 746778
273 747295 770351 21
See more
676090645 467734 23461534
586497787 5304426 1595
See more